The ingredients needed to prepare Nasi Lemak (Rice Cooked in Coconut Milk):
  1. Prepare 800 ml Thai rice or long-stored rice
  2. Use 200 ml Coconut milk
  3. Get 1 heaping tablespoon Salt
  4. You need 2 leaves Pandan leaves (optional)
  5. Use Side dish recommendations:
  6. Take 1 Sambal*Must have
  7. Prepare 1 egg per serving Sunny-side up or boiled eggs
  8. Use 1 egg per serving Sambal Terur
  9. Prepare 1 Sliced cucumbers
  10. Take 1 Vinegar-fried peanuts
  11. Take 1 or 1 fish per serving Deep fried chirimen jako or small mackerel
  12. Prepare 1 Deep fried tempeh
  13. Prepare 1 Wiener sausages, etc.
  14. Take Fancy side dish recommendations:
  15. Take 1 per serving Fried chicken wings
  16. Prepare 1 Fried squid rings
Steps to make Nasi Lemak (Rice Cooked in Coconut Milk):
  1. Wash the rice and then put it in the rice cooker. There's no need to soak the rice. Wash the pandan leaves and tie them in a knot. If they are dehydrated, then just put them in directly as is.
  2. Add salt to the rice and then pour in the coconut milk. Adjust as necessary with some water, if necessary. Mix it well. The liquid should be slightly lower than the 4 cup mark. Add the pandan leaves and cook the rice.
  3. Here is the cooked rice.Take out the pandan leaves and mix well.
  4. Mix in some sambal while eating.
